Family Fun & Fido Walk – April 10, 2010 at Equestrian Park

Family Fun & Fido Walk Equestrian Park ● All ages ● 10:00 a.m.-noon ● Free Bring your family and leashed pet to Equestrian Park for Henderson Family Fun & Fido Walk. This 2-mile fun walk will be held on Equestrian Trail, a paved loop trail perfect for strollers, bikes, pets, and families. Follow the signs and participate in fun activities along the way. Kids 12 and under must be accompanied by a parent or guardian. Teens (ages 13-17) require a parent/guardian’s signature on a waiver. Advance registration and onsite registration are available.  follow link http://www.cityofhenderson.com/parks/whats-new/happening-now.php#fido

Fido Walk on lease.....file photo

The River Mountains Trail Partnership will be at the one-mile turn around booth handing out maps and trail information….see you there.
